Backhoe loader tyres: questions and answers

Why identify front or rear on a backhoe loader?

The tyre sizes and applications can differ, so a general machine description does not establish the correct fitment.

What should I provide when enquiring about backhoe loader tyres?

Provide machine model and identify whether the work concerns a front or rear wheel. Provide the machine model and exact site position. Confirm a suitable maintenance area and access for the equipment needed to handle the tyre.

What affects the quotation for backhoe loader tyres?

The quotation depends on machine and tyre size, construction, handling requirements and the work location. A quotation should confirm the agreed scope, supply and fitting before work is arranged.
